The Benefits of Double Glazing Replacement Windows

Double-glazed replacement double glazing windows windows give homeowners a number of advantages. They can cut down on heat loss in winter, glare, and shield furniture from damage caused by sun.

Double glazed windows are made consisting of two glass panes that are separated by an air gap, which is filled with an insulating gas such as argon. This improves the insulation properties of the window.

Energy efficiency

Double glazing can make your home more efficient. It helps to keep your home warm and stops cold air from entering. It can also save you money on your energy bills, and help to reduce carbon emissions.

There are several types of double glazing. You must decide which one is suitable for your home. You can choose between single-glazed, double-glazed with low-e glass, or triple-glazed options. These windows are all designed to improve energy efficiency for your home. They can help to reduce the cost of energy and keep your home warmer and quieter.

The main difference between single glazed and double glazed is that the latter features two panes, with a gap between them. The gap is filled with a gas like argon or krypton. This can help reduce heat loss and increase the insulation of the window. The frame of a double-glazed window is typically made from uPVC, or sometimes timber. This can increase the energy efficiency.

If you are seeking the most energy efficient double glazing, then you should look for windows that have a low emissivity (low-e) coating on both the outer and inner panes. This will limit the amount of heat that will traverse the windows and into your home. For optimal performance, opt for double-glazed windows with a minimum 12mm gas gap and fill them with the gas argon.

Some pre-made, or stock replacement windows that are sold in large home-supply stores and lumberyards stores are double-glazed. These are usually cheaper than bespoke replacement windows, but they may not be as efficient as you'd think. These windows could also have spacers made of steel which could reduce energy efficiency. In order to maximize the performance of your double-glazed windows you should choose spacers that have very little or no metal. They are referred to as "warm edge" spacers.

It is important to note that the frame quality is just as important as the double glazing. Avoid buying cheap, poorly-insulated windows set in frames that aren't of the highest quality. This could cause condensation or draughts in your home. You can reduce this risk by installing a new frame that has double-glazing. This will reduce the amount of energy lost through your windows and guarantee an excellent product.

Condensation

Double glazing can be affected by condensation, which is more common as winter approaches. If you have a new double glazed window, condensation should not be a cause for concern, as it indicates that the windows are functioning well and helping to keep your home energy efficient. If, however, you have older double glazed windows and notice that the internal window pane is cloudy, this could indicate that the seal between the glass has failed.

In certain cases, the windows may have been damaged during installation. This will cause the window to lose the pressure of air, which can lead to condensation. In these situations, you should call the company that installed your windows and report the problem. They'll likely repair the affected units at no cost. However, it is important to remember that any modification to the units or attempting to repair them yourself could void the warranty and could cause damage to the frame in its entirety.

Most condensation in double-glazed windows is caused by a broken seal between the panes of glass. These seals are designed to keep heat from escaping and reduce the cost of energy. This type of issue typically is seen in older double glazed windows, but it can be seen in newer windows.

There are a variety of solutions to the condensation issue. You can make use of an extractor fan or even open your window. Alternatively, you can also utilize trickle vents for your windows and doors. These simple fixes won't work if there is a broken seal between the glass replacement on windows.

If you have double glazed windows that aren't functioning correctly, you should call the company that installed them and let them know about the issue. If they have been in use for less than a decade, you should be able to obtain a replacement window under warranty. This will help you save money while improving the aesthetics of your house. Noise

Double glazing is not just useful in reducing energy losses but also help with noise reduction. It adds a layer of insulation, preventing sound from escaping through the walls and into your home. This can be especially helpful if you live near a busy road or other noisy location. Noise pollution can have a significant effect on your health, so it's important to take steps to minimize it.

Sound is a form of sound that travels through the air molecules and solid objects until it gets to your ears. These vibrations are measured by decibels which are higher decibels signifying louder sounds. The sound of a jet or someone speaking next to you can create stress levels and disrupt your sleep patterns. Double glazing can cut down on the volume of noise by up to 35 decibels, making your home a more peaceful place.

Replacement-Windows-150x150.jpgThe type of double-glazed glass you select will also affect the amount of noise it can block. Float glass is the most common kind, and although it isn't as thick as other options but it does offer a high degree of sound resistance. Other options include sound-absorbing glass that is laminated. The thickness of the glass as well as the space between the panes are crucial.

A good quality double glazed window will have an acoustic rating, which shows how well it will reduce outside noise. The higher the acoustic rating, the more effective. You should aim to get the minimum RW 45 that will shield your ears from the most common outside noise.

Double glazing using different pane thicknesses will give the most effective acoustic results. The reason behind this is that sound waves travel more easily through thin glass, whereas thicker glass window replacement near me will block them from traveling through. The gap between the panes could also affect the sound insulation of double-glazed windows.

In addition to the reduction of outside noise, double-glazed windows will also limit UV rays that can damage your furniture. This is particularly important when your furniture is located near the window, as prolonged exposure to UV rays may cause it discoloration.
